flash on 2011-12-11

by 3f5
♥0 | Line 20 | Modified 2011-12-11 15:03:31 | MIT License
play

ActionScript3 source code

/**
 * Copyright 3f5 ( http://wonderfl.net/user/3f5 )
 * MIT License ( http://www.opensource.org/licenses/mit-license.php )
 * Downloaded from: http://wonderfl.net/c/A2Nz
 */

package {
    import flash.display.BitmapData;
    import flash.display.Bitmap;
    import flash.display.Sprite;
    public class FlashTest extends Sprite {
        public function FlashTest() {
            var bitmap:BitmapData = new BitmapData(465, 465);
            addChild(new Bitmap(bitmap));

            bitmap.lock();

            for (var i:uint = 0; i < 100000; i++) {
                bitmap.setPixel(Math.floor(kusoRand() * 465), Math.floor(kusoRand() * 465), 0x000000);
            }

            bitmap.unlock();
        }
        
        private function kusoRand():Number {
            var time:Number = new Date().time / 1000;
            
            return time - ~~time;
        }

    }
}